Have you ever known something will happen, but not had the exact details of it? It’s somewhat the same with Christ’s return for us, we know it is looming but we don’t have a concrete date. This is something for us to reflect on as we consider Today’s Holy Nougat.

Matthew 24:36 NIV

[36] “But about that day or hour no one knows, not even the angels in heaven, nor the Son, but only the Father.

No One Knows

Siblings, we’ve read of others being annoyed with Y’shua, to the extent that they wanted Him dead … but His time has not yet come. From such incidents and our Nougat, we may conclude that YHWH operates with very precise timing. Yet, YHWH doesn’t always reveal the full details of the date and time for what God is doing. That may be due to YHWH’s timing being different from ours, ‘a thousand years in our human time is like a day’, or simply that YHWH gives us enough information to mobilise us for a task so that we operate in faith. After all, we live by faith and not always in the concrete and provable.

Ironically, the dearth of exact data has been a stumbling block for some who need concrete facts with which to work. Some have even interpreted YHWH’s ‘delays’ as proof that YHWH doesn’t exist. But what if the delay was actually YHWH’s provision for us so that we might not perish?
